Company Overview

The Oklahoma Ready Mixed Concrete Association (ORMCA) is a statewide trade organization dedicated to advancing the ready mixed concrete industry across Oklahoma. The association represents concrete producers, suppliers, and industry partners, working to promote quality, safety, and sustainability in concrete production and construction.

ORMCA supports its members through advocacy, education, and industry collaboration. The association provides certification and training programs to ensure a skilled workforce, hosts events and conferences that foster networking and professional development, and serves as a unified voice on legislative and regulatory issues impacting the industry.

By connecting industry professionals and promoting best practices, ORMCA plays a vital role in strengthening Oklahoma’s infrastructure and supporting the continued growth of the construction and concrete industries statewide.

Company History

Founded in 1957, the Oklahoma Ready Mixed Concrete Association (ORMCA) was established to unify and represent the interests of ready mixed concrete producers and industry partners across the state. Formed as a professional trade organization, ORMCA has grown alongside Oklahoma’s construction industry, serving as a central resource for collaboration, education, and advocacy.
